Terence Crawford Reflects On Masterclass Win, Legacy And Boxing’s Future

  1. Terence Crawford joins Joe Rogan to break down his dominant win over Errol Spence Jr., detailing the years-long business and political battle to finally make the fight and the strategic choices that led to his performance. He explains how switching stances, minimal film study, and deep trust in his coaches shaped his style, and why mental toughness from a rough upbringing fuels his drive. Crawford lays out his ambitions to chase all‑time‑great status by moving up three weight classes to fight Canelo Alvarez and become undisputed in a third division. The conversation also dives into fighter pay, sanctioning bodies, health, and why boxing and MMA athletes deserve structural protection like pensions and unions.

IDEAS WORTH REMEMBERING

5 ideas

Crawford’s Spence performance was the culmination of years of blocked negotiations and calculated patience.

He describes chasing Spence for about five years, leaving Top Rank, and personally contacting Spence to bypass managers when talks kept stalling over what Crawford saw as unfair business terms.

His ‘masterclass’ style comes from drilling scenarios and adjusting in real time, not obsessive film study.

Crawford watches only a couple of fights per opponent, lets his coaches build the game plan, and prides himself on making reads and adjustments on the fly during the fight.

Switch-hitting is a weapon he developed deliberately and against advice, now central to his dominance.

Early on, his coach tried to stop him from switching stances, but once he kept winning that way, they built camp around training both orthodox and southpaw, giving him power and options in either stance.

Crawford is now motivated almost entirely by legacy, especially a historic jump to fight Canelo at 168.

He says he’s financially set and could retire, but wants unprecedented greatness: becoming undisputed in a third division by jumping from 147 to 168 to fight the Canelo–Charlo winner.

He believes boxing’s structure is broken and fighters need systemic protections.

Crawford criticizes sanctioning bodies for taking 2–3% of purses, calls for fewer belts, more transparency in drug testing, and says fighters should have pensions, unions, health insurance, and 401(k)-style plans.
